Output 901b780875187b66186409f981a16025b8a48e2934d1d0d3774c9520803412e8:1

value
26478204
script pubkey
OP_0 OP_PUSHBYTES_20 7b0f15416898546e0fafafb76e61f4e2d70763f7
address
bc1q0v832stgnp2xura047mkuc05uttswclhyssr3a
transaction
901b780875187b66186409f981a16025b8a48e2934d1d0d3774c9520803412e8
confirmations
41475
spent
true